Analysis

Democratic People's Republic of Korea recorded 582,418 kg for chickens, layers — manure applied to soils that leaches in 2023. That is the lowest value across all 63 years on record.

Compared with earlier readings it is down 10.0% on the previous year and down 55.7% over ten years.

Over the whole period, chickens, layers — manure applied to soils that leaches in Democratic People's Republic of Korea peaked at 1.71 million kg in 1991 and was at its lowest, 582,418 kg, in 2023.

That places Democratic People's Republic of Korea 12th out of 20 countries with data for 2023, putting it in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 63 years of available data.

The Livestock Manure domain of FAOSTAT contains estimates of nitrogen (N) inputs to agricultural soils from livestock manure. Data on the N losses to air and water are also disseminated. These estimates are compiled using official FAOSTAT statistics of animal stocks and by applying the internationally approved Guidelines of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C). Data are available by country, with global coverage and updated annually.The following elements are disseminated: 1) Stocks; 2) Amount excreted in manure (N content); 3) Manure left on pasture (N content); 4) Manure left on pasture that volatilises (N content); 5) Manure left on pasture that leaches (N content); 6) Manure treated (N content); 7) Losses from manure treated (N content); 8) Manure applied to soils (N content); 9) Manure applied to soils that volatilises (N content); 10) Manure applied to soils that leaches (N content).
